I'm So Glad I Met You is a fascinating little drama that dives into the chaos of memory and the blurred lines of intoxication. The film captures this hazy atmosphere, with a tone that swings between wistfulness and confusion, almost mirroring the protagonist’s state of mind. The pacing is deliberately slow, allowing you to really sit with the character’s thoughts as she pieces together her night. The performances have this raw, almost gritty quality that pulls you in, making the awkward moments feel real. There’s something distinct about how it handles the themes of connection and isolation, particularly in the way it unfolds the encounter, leaving you pondering long after it ends.
I'm So Glad I Met You has had limited releases, making it somewhat of a hidden gem among collectors. Its scarcity is due to the unknown director and the film's indie roots, which can make finding a physical copy a challenge. However, it garners interest for its authentic portrayal of life's messiness and the emotional nuances within a single night. The film's unique storytelling style and atmospheric qualities are what keep collectors intrigued.
